self.decode64(data)
Decodes a base 64 encoded string to its original representation.
ActiveSupport::Base64.decode64("T3JpZ2luYWwgdW5lbmNvZGVkIHN0cmluZw==") # => "Original unencoded string"

Source
# File activesupport/lib/active_support/base64.rb, line 21
def self.decode64(data)
data.unpack("m").first
end
